Runbook: Scanline barcode bridge

If warehouse scans stop flowing into Cartwheel, it's almost always the bridge service on the Dunmore floor box wedging after a USB hiccup. Bounce the service first — nine times out of ten that fixes it. If not, check the queue depth before escalating. When restarting, make sure the bridge comes up with these settings.

deployment values, yafop-bajef:
[gilok]
team = ulaius
access_code = ac_423664
host = gilok.sivrelhq.corp
port = 9200
owner = pelius.istax
peer = eliok.torvasoft.internal

Subject: Lintbase cut-over done

Team — the static-analysis baseline cut-over for Kettlewing finished Tuesday. Old baseline file is frozen; new one is generated nightly from the trunk scan. All 212 suppressed findings carried over, 9 were dropped as fixed. CI now fails on any new finding not in the baseline. Rollback is a one-line revert in the pipeline repo. No incidents so far. The scanner service now runs with the following configuration.

config for tajof-kawep:
[aldius]
port = 3000
region = lower-2
host = aldius.plorvasoft.example
team = eliius
timeout_ms = 750
retries = 6

CI note: the Bramblewick pipeline trips its circuit breaker when the upstream Quotely API returns three consecutive 5xx responses. Builds then fail fast with BREAKER_OPEN. Don't retry blindly — wait for the 90-second half-open window, or the breaker re-latches. Check the Quotely status job first; if it's green, clear the breaker cache and rerun. Quote this token when escalating.

trace token, fafof-tajef: htk9_849b0fd88